Eagles, Saints square off with winner facing Rams in NFC title game

The divisional games end with the Philadelphia Eagles and the New Orleans Saints. Here’s all the pertinent info for the game.

The NFC divisional rounds conclude this evening with the New Orleans Saints gearing up to host the Philadelphia Eagles. The game kicks off at 1:30 p.m PT on FOX, with Kevin Burkhardt on play-by-play. Charles Davis has the commentary

The Philadelphia Eagles surprised a lot of people last week by beating the Chicago Bears. Some of this is on Philadelphia getting a go-ahead score in the final seconds to take the lead, and some of this is on Bears kicker Cody Parkey for whiffing on a short, walk-off field goal. The Bears have gone home and the Eagles advance to keep their two-peat hopes alive.

The Saints are either the biggest sleepers of the year or the ones to win it all this year depending on who you talk to. All the talk has been the Los Angeles Rams and Kansas City Chiefs, but the Saints have been dominating their opponents and when they can’t get the points, they find ways to take care of business. The rebuild they have had officially ended with their playoff appearance last year, and this year, they might be better than their Super Bowl team from a decade ago.

This game brings the biggest spread of the weekend, with the Saints sitting at -8. A majority of the public is riding the Eagles once again, which brought the line down a point to a point and a half, depending on your sportsbook of choice. The Saints are the very clearly better team, but the Eagles remaining perpetually scary. They are in New Orleans and the Saints are a different team at home. I’m taking the Saints for this one.
